A. Prior to purchasing undyed special fuel for nontaxable purposes, a user must meet the following requirements and conditions in order to file a claim for refund or credit.

(1)The user must make application to receive approval from the Department of Revenue, on forms prescribed by the secretary, stating the purposes for which such fuel will be used.
(2)The user must furnish a copy of the department's approval to his supplier prior to purchasing fuel. B. Users, meeting the qualifications of Subsection A, who have paid the taxes levied under R.S. 47:802(A) and 820.1(A) on undyed special fuels may obtain a refund when the fuel is used for a purpose other than in a vehicle licensed or required to be licensed for highway use.
